Output 84d695147f5e34912c3ee58db5357954e12d402e909660a72217479fcf27e23e:1

value
27562443
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7be861c51869edc8313625cf7c52ed47ca13edb4 OP_EQUAL
address
MKCKjCmgXWgx59XKhzNNwMCAPgTEaM38tD
transaction
84d695147f5e34912c3ee58db5357954e12d402e909660a72217479fcf27e23e
spent
true